After two weeks of being in-transit from Sydney Australia, today I finally received the 1961-1964 Australian Ford Trucks Chassis and Parts Catalogue.
I spent the evening transcribing the data tag decoding information to the website at FORDification.info.

However, I was a little disappointed that the Soft Trim section which should have included Trim code information was non-existent. In fact, the entire Soft Trim section is comprised of a single page, front and back, with part numbers for seat upholstery and headliner pieces...nothing else. However, the PN listings for the upholstery show a 'O.N.R.' abbreviation that I'm unfamiliar with. Does anyone know what that stands for?
Also, the 1961 paint codes are somewhat confusing. The illustration shown for the '61 data tag shows a four-digit number, with each digit representing the primer, roof color, center color and lower color, but the codes in the paint section show a single letter for each of the three available paint codes.
Can anyone shed some light on these items so I can fine-tune and complete these pages? Thanks!
